#7b7a64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b7a64 is composed of 48.2% red, 47.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 18.7%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 57.4 degrees, a saturation of 10.3% and a lightness of 43.7%. #7b7a64 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6f4c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#7b7a64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b7a64 has RGB values of R:123, G:122,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.19,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8092260.
